Father of Late Osanju Seeks Burial Support

Agya K and Osanju

The father of popular Ghanaian TikToker and content creator, Elvis Frimpong, widely known as Osanju, has spoken publicly for the first time since his son’s sudden passing.

In a video, Agya K, as he is affectionately called, was visibly emotional as he called for assistance to give his son a befitting burial. “I will need help to bury my son. I can’t face this tragedy alone,” he said in tears.

When asked about the cause of death, Osanju’s father recounted that his son was born with certain stomach complications, though he later recovered.

“To be honest, I realised some complications with my son after he was born, and I don’t know what it was. But he was healed after a certain woman took care of him.”

Agya K

He further revealed that Osanju’s health began to deteriorate again shortly after the passing of his mother five months ago, forcing the family to make frequent hospital visits.

According to his father, the late TikTok star had been struggling with health issues in recent months. Before his death, Osanju himself disclosed in a video that he had been diagnosed with Chronic Myeloid Leukemia, a form of blood cancer, which his father strongly believes the illness ultimately claimed his life.

Osanju died on September 1, 2025, just hours after sharing what would become his final video on TikTok. His passing has since shocked fans and followers, many of whom have taken to social media to express their grief.

As the family prepares for the funeral, Agya K’s plea for support highlights the weight of the tragedy they now face.

Ghanaian Man Raises Awareness on Leukaemia

Ghanaian Man Raises Awareness on Leukaemia
Yeboah and Osanju

A Ghanaian man stirred reactions on social media after sharing his thoughts on leukaemia, believed to be the cause of TikTok star Osanju, born Elvis Frimpong’s death.

Commenting on this, Yeboah advised Ghanaians, especially parents, to be more cautious about some daily practices that could increase their risk of developing the disease.

According to him, who is apparently a medical laboratory scientist, eating food directly from rubber bags can lead to blood cancer.

He disclosed that doing such is not ideal because the chemicals from the bags can seep through into meals.

He also highlighted the dangers that Ghanaian farmers frequently face in exposing themselves to pesticides and unwanted grass control. He added that those who work in the mortuaries and are constantly in contact with formaldehyde are susceptible to the illness.

According to him, such exposures can trigger genetic mutations that may lead to leukaemia, a type of blood cancer. He urged Ghanaians to be vigilant about their food handling and environmental exposures.

The video has since sparked conversations online, with many commending his effort to shed light on health risks in everyday life.

Prophet Shares New Prophecy on Osanju’s Death

Prophet Shares New Prophecy on Osanju's Death
Prophet and Osanju

A Ghanaian prophet caused a stir after he reacted to the passing of a popular Ghanaian TikToker.

Prophet Tabiri claimed he foresaw that the chronic illness troubling Osanju had a spiritual dimension.

He added that one factor that worked against the TikToker was his religious belief, which led him to refuse spiritual help from other quarters.

Prophet Tabiri then dropped a bombshell when he stated that the TikToker would be reborn.

He explained that it would be an individual from the same family who would give birth to the reincarnated Osanju.
